Purpose & Scope

The Assistant Patient Care Director is responsible for direction of the nursing unit(s) in coordination with the patient care director in concert with the goals of that unit according to the philosophy of the Division of Patient Care Services. The responsibility includes unit administration, direct nursing care and coordinating activities with ancillary departments. The assistant patient care director reports to the patient care director.

Education

  • Bachelor's degree in Nursing from an accredited School of Nursing required.
  • One year of experience in nursing / patient care required.
  • One year of demonstrated leadership ability required.

Certification/Licensure

  • Licensed as a Registered Nurse by the Virginia Department of Health Professions or Compact State Licensure in Nursing is required.
  • Certification in Area of Clinical Specialty is preferred.
  • BLS Certification is required.
